Synergistic extraction of heavy rare earths by mixture of α-aminophosphonic acid HEHAMP and HEHEHP

 
 
 
 
 
 
 

Abstract


Abstract Synergistic extraction of heavy rare earths (REs) were investigated in chloride media by the mixture of (2-ethylhexylamino)methyl phosphonic acid mono-2-ethylhexyl ester (HEHAMP) and 2-ethylhexyl phosphoric acid mono-2-ethylhexyl ester (HEHEHP). The maximum synergistic enhancement coefficients (R) of Lu, Yb, Tm, Er, Y and Ho are 2.89, 2.76, 2.54, 2.14, 2.14 and 2.06, respectively, when the mole fraction XHEHAMP is 0.5. The synergistic separation factors of the heavy REs are obtained (βY/Ho\xa0=\xa01.31, βEr/Y\xa0=\xa01.61, βTm/Er\xa0=\xa01.78, βYb/Tm\xa0=\xa01.76, βLu/Yb\xa0=\xa01.20). The extracted complex is determined to be RE[H(EHAMP)2][H(EHEHP)2]2 by the slope analysis method. The loading capacities of the mixtures consisting of 15% HEHAMP and 15% HEHEHP for Y and Lu are about 26.59\xa0g/L (Yb2O3) and 27.25\xa0g/L (Lu2O3), respectively.
